About the Role

Citi South Africa is inviting graduates to join its one-year Learnership Graduate Program in Investment Banking. This exciting programme is designed for recent graduates ready to bring classroom knowledge into the corporate world, gain exposure to global financial markets, and kickstart a long-term career in banking.

During the year-long programme, graduates will:

  • Gain practical work experience across various Citi businesses.

  • Be sponsored for a postgraduate qualification relevant to their field.

  • Have the opportunity to apply for permanent positions within the organisation.


Who Should Apply?

  • Graduates with an undergraduate degree (GPA 65% & above) or a master’s degree in any discipline.

  • Maximum 1 year of work experience (optional).

  • Strong leadership, teamwork, and communication skills.

  • Passion for learning and a genuine interest in global finance and investment banking.
